Ukrainian Foreign Minister Sybiha: Russia remains stuck in the past
Kyiv, May 19 (Hibya) – Ukrainian Foreign Minister Andrii Sybiha stated that the recent meeting held in Istanbul once again clearly revealed the difference in approach between Ukraine and Russia.
Sybiha emphasized that Ukraine is focused on achieving a full and immediate ceasefire to begin a forward-looking and genuine peace process, while Russia, he claimed, remains trapped in the past.
"Russia rejects a ceasefire and constantly refers to the 2022 Istanbul talks, bringing up the same irrational demands it made three years ago," said Sybiha, stressing that this attitude undermines the peace process.
Minister Sybiha also noted that Moscow must now realize the consequences of obstructing peace and called for increased international pressure on Russia.
